Mumbai: All broadband internet users in India can now access Tata Indicom's entire portfolio of VAS offerings like global roaming, net telephony, entertainment and business services.

The company has launched a unique product in India, Tata Indicom Extra, that allows all all broadband, dial up connection users in India - irrespective of their internet service provider - access Tata Communications' portfolio of value added services like global internet roaming, net telephony, Wi-Fi, movies, music and over 150 business and home applications.

This is the first time in India that VAS offerings of one ISP are being made available to all internet users even though they may be subscribers of other ISPs.

Tata Indicom Extra is a convenient pre-paid card that a user can purchase offline or online, register, and start using.

These cards can be bought in denominations ranging from Rs200 to Rs6,500, giving complete freedom and ease to customers in selecting a service they wish to enjoy. These include access to over 500 Tata Indicom Wi-Fi hotspots in India and over 100,000 globally, global internet roaming at over 160 countries, and a wide array of content services specially collated for home and business users like PC security, domain registration, music download, etc.
